I have this one in blue. Got it from Petsmart. I like it and it works fine for just one furbaby. I'm tall and when I push this stroller I tend to hunch over and this gets uncomfortable after a while. Its pretty light and easy to store in the car...plenty of room on the bottom to store stuff.

I also have this All Terrain stroller. I bought this for both Chloe and Bella to ride in together. It's larger than the Happy Trails one I have. The ride is smoother and the height suits me. I'm not hunched over pushing this around. I like all the storage it has also. It is a little bulkier than the Happy Trails but folds easy. It is large enough I think I could put another dog in with Chloe (11 lbs) and Bella( 4-5 lbs).
